facebook30 twitter30

facebook30 twitter30


Information: Check our FAQ page for answering questions regarding ordering, log-in, registration, test kit reporting.

If your question is not addressed in the FAQ, please fill in the email form. We answer your questions within 24-hours.

 422 Larkfield Center, #255
Santa Rosa CA 95403
United States

Tel: 1-641-715-3800 x869964#

1000 characters left